Please refrain from comparing one class of theory or hypothesis to another (e.g. LIHOP vs MIHOP) on the "LIHOP Hypotheses" subforum. There is another subforum for discussing the classification of hypotheses or theories as well as the general issues regarding the different classes.

Hypotheses should be broken down into who did what, when they did it, and what evidence supports these claims. It is fine to build theories dependent on a number of hypotheses, however all supporting hypotheses should be supported. If a hypothesis can not be supported or disproven, it may or may not be a candidate for new investigation. There is another subforum for discussing the relative merit of unsupported hypotheses and the feasiblity or importance of investigating such a hypothesis.
